The question of when to take probiotics-morning or night-is intriguing because it touches on gut microbiota dynamics, circadian biology, and individual lifestyle factors. Current research suggests that timing can influence probiotic efficacy, though definitive conclusions are still emerging.
The human digestive system, including gut microbiota, exhibits circadian rhythms. These daily fluctuations affect gut motility, enzyme production, pH levels, and immune responses, all of which can impact probiotic survival and colonization. For instance, some studies indicate that taking probiotics on an empty stomach, often in the morning before breakfast or at night before bed, may improve bacterial survival because stomach acid levels are generally lower, reducing the likelihood probiotics are destroyed before reaching the intestines.
Taking probiotics at night might indeed provide a more stable environment for beneficial bacteria to flourish. During sleep, digestive activity slows, potentially promoting better bacterial adherence and colonization in the gut. Moreover, the gut’s reduced motility overnight might allow probiotics more time to interact with intestinal walls and influence immune modulation.
Conversely, morning intake aligns probiotic introduction with the natural metabolic ramp-up after fasting. Eating breakfast soon after may provide substrates to encourage probiotic growth.
Individual lifestyle factors-diet quality, meal timing, sleep patterns, and medication use-also play significant roles. A diet rich in prebiotics supports probiotic effectiveness regardless of timing, and irregular sleep or eating schedules may blunt circadian modulation effects.
In summary, while timing can influence probiotic performance, it is not the sole determinant of benefit. Consistency and taking probiotics when convenient and sustainable often matter more than exact timing. Personal experimentation combined with attention to diet and lifestyle remains the best approach.
